Activating Compound | Comment | Organism | Structure |
---|---|---|---|
[1,1,3,3-tetramethylguanidine][lactate] | increase in concentration of [1,1,3,3-tetramethylguanidine][Lac] up to 0.25 M increases enzyme activity, and at concentrations more than 0.25 M enzyme activity is decreased. Optimum temperature and thermal stability studies show more stability of luciferase only in the presence of [1,1,3,3-tetramethylguanidine][Lac] | Photinus pyralis | |
[1,1,3,3-tetramethylguanidine][propionate] | in the presence of [1,1,3,3-tetramethylguanidine][propionate], enzyme activities are decreased with an increase in ionic liquid concentration | Photinus pyralis |
